Linux vi 命令的详细说明

小夏 科技 更新 2024-01-30

VI是一个非常常用的文本编辑器,在Linux系统中被广泛使用。 它具有强大的功能和灵活的操作方式,能够满足各种编辑文本文件的需求。 本文将详细扩展Linux VI命令的使用,包括VI的启动、退出、移动、编辑和保存操作。 它重点介绍使用 vi 命令进行文件编辑的技巧和注意事项。 通过本文,读者将能够熟练使用 vi 命令编辑文本文件。

1.启动、退出和基本操作。

1.开始 vi:

在 Linux 终端中输入 vi 命令,然后输入文件名以启动 vi。 如果文件存在,它将被打开;如果该文件不存在,则创建一个同名的新文件。 例如:vi 文件txt

2.出口六:

在命令模式下输入冒号 (:)然后输入 Q 退出 VI。 如果文件内容被修改,会提示是否保存更改。 若要强制退出而不保存更改,请输入冒号,后跟 q!。 例如:q或:q!

3.移动光标:

使用 H、J、K 和 L 键分别向左、向下、向上和向右移动光标使用 gg 和 g 命令将光标分别移动到文件的开头和结尾使用数字 + n 将光标向前移动 n 行;使用数字 + ng 将光标移动到文件的第 n 行。

2. 编辑文件。

1.插入文本:

按i键进入插入模式,可以自由编辑和插入文本。

2.删除和复制文本:

在命令模式下,可以使用 x 命令删除光标位置处的字符使用 dd 命令删除光标所在的行使用 yy 命令复制光标所在的行。

3.撤消操作:

在命令模式下,输入 u 命令以撤消上一个操作。

3. 保存并退出文件。

1.保存文件:

在命令模式下,输入冒号 (:)后跟 w 以保存文件。 例如::w

2.另存为:

在命令模式下,输入冒号 (:)后跟 w,后跟文件名,以将当前文件另存为指定的文件名。 例如:w newfiletxt

3.保存并退出:

在命令模式下,输入冒号 (:),然后输入 wq 以保存文件并退出。 例如::wq

4. 查找和替换。

1.在文件中找到:

在命令模式下,输入斜杠 ( ),后跟要查找的内容,然后按 Enter 键开始搜索。 按 n 键继续查找下一个匹配项。

2.替代文本:

在命令模式下,输入冒号(:)然后输入 s 需要替换的内容,然后按 Enter 替换操作。 例如:要将所有苹果替换为橙色,请输入命令:%s apple orange g

5.扩展功能。

1.多窗口模式:

在命令模式下,输入冒号(:)然后拆分,将当前窗口拆分为两个窗口,可以同时查看和编辑不同的文件内容。

2.使用宏录制:

在命令模式下,输入 q,然后输入一个字母(表示宏的名称),然后编辑几次,最后输入 q 结束录制。 然后输入 @ 的名称,后跟宏,您可以重复之前录制的操作。

3.自动完成:

在命令模式下,按 Ctrl 和 N 键可自动完成当前单词。

简介: 本文详细介绍了Linux VI命令的用法,包括启动、退出、移动、编辑、保存、查找和替换。 正确使用 vi 命令可以让我们更有效地编辑文本文件。 掌握vi命令的基本操作和快捷键,再加上丰富的编辑技巧,可以大大提高我们的编辑效率。 建议读者对文中提到的每个操作进行练习,以加深对vi命令的理解和记忆,并熟练掌握实际使用。 通过不断的练习和实践,相信你一定能够灵活地在Linux系统中使用vi命令,轻松处理各种文本编辑任务。

如有疑问,可以留言或私信我,欢迎关注我【点击关注】,一起**。

搜索主题 12月全日制挑战赛

相似文章

    发现 wiki Linux Vi 命令的奥秘和魅力

    Linux 命令 在数字世界中,Linux VI 命令是一个极具争议的存在。一方面,它是一个强大的文本编辑工具,另一方面,它也是一个令人望而却步的引擎。然而,正是这个谜团使 vi 成为程序员最喜爱的工具之一。在本文中,我们将仔细研究 Linux VI 命令的使用,揭开它们的神秘面纱,并带您了解它们生...

    如何使用 cadfrom 命令

    在AutoCAD中,CADFROM命令是一个非常有用的工具,可将其他CAD文件格式转换为DWG或DXF格式,以便在AutoCAD中打开和使用。以下是如何使用 cadfrom 命令。首先,打开AutoCAD软件,在命令行中键入 cadfrom 然后按Enter键。此时,将弹出一个对话框,其中包含 输入...

    如何使用 cadfrom 命令?指南使用教程

    以下是使用 cad from 命令的详细指南。.概述 CAD 自 命令是 CAD 软件中的一个重要命令,它允许用户从已知基点开始,并通过指定偏移来确定新点。此命令在CAD绘图中非常有用,可以帮助用户快速准确地定位点,提高绘图效率。.命令调用 要调用 cad from 命令,您可以在键盘上键入 fro...

    CentOS 常用关机命令

    CentOS是服务器和云计算领域广泛使用的Linux发行版之一。使用 CentOS 时,有时需要关闭或重新启动系统。本文介绍如何使用CentOS shutdown命令。.关机命令。shutdown 命令是 CentOS 中常用的 shutdown 命令之一。它可用于关闭或重新启动系统。使用此命令时,...

    python exit loop 命令

    在 Python 中,我们经常使用 loop 语句,例如 for 循环和 while 循环,来重复执行某些块。但有时我们需要提前退出整个循环,结束 的运行。Python 中提供了一些语句和方法来实现退出循环的功能,我将详细介绍给大家。break 语句可以立即退出最近的 for 或 while 循环以...